New Employee Orientation Overview
Here’s a quick overview of what to expect at Orientation
as a new employee of Texas Health.
You will receive detailed information about orientation during your HR preboarding meeting and a finalized schedule once you have completed the preboarding process.
Orientation – Day 1
Who: New Employees of Texas Health
What: New Employee Orientation is designed to give all new employees a broad overview of the identity, mission, vision, and values of Texas Health. Although Texas Health has many hospitals and facilities, we have one Texas Health identity.
Where: 600 E. Lamar Blvd., Arlington, TX 76112
Orientation – Day 2
Who: New Employees of Texas Health
What: Entity Welcome Orientation is held on every Tuesday for all new staff. This is an opportunity to get a feel for the culture and meet with senior leadership.
Where: Your home entity location
Orientation – Day 3
Who: New Clinical Employees of Texas Health
What: Acute Care Clinical Orientation is held on Wednesdays for all new clinical staff who are in direct patient care.
Where: 600 E. Lamar Blvd., Arlington, TX 76112
More info
Do you work with direct patient care in INPATIENT areas?
If Yes: You will attend Acute Care Clinical Orientation
If No: You will NOT attend Acute Care Clinical Orientation
Most clinical roles require additional training and departmental orientation.
